當(dāng)前位置:首頁 > 電腦軟件 > 辦公軟件 > UGit軟件

UGit軟件

版本:v5.26.1 大小:365.17M 語言:簡體中文 類別:辦公軟件
  • 本地下載
5.0
0% 0%

情介紹

UGit是一款騰訊自研的Git客戶端,旨在為開發(fā)者提供更高效、便捷的代碼版本控制體驗。軟件集成了Git的核心功能,并在此基礎(chǔ)上進行了優(yōu)化和擴展,使得代碼的提交、合并、分支管理等操作更加流暢。

UGit軟件十分注重保護用戶的代碼安全,提供了代碼加密存儲和傳輸?shù)墓δ埽_保數(shù)據(jù)的安全。還提供了便捷的大文件管理、快速提交、工蜂鎖機制以及支持檢出子目錄等特性,同時還支持團隊協(xié)作,使得多人開發(fā)時能夠輕松地進行權(quán)限分配和代碼審查,提升了團隊開發(fā)的效率和質(zhì)量!

UGit軟件使用介紹

【便捷的大文件管理】

1、內(nèi)置LFS模版,騰訊眾多大型項目LFS管理經(jīng)驗沉淀,尤其是游戲項目。

2、支持對倉庫或工作區(qū)進行大文件分析,以便于更好的配置Git LFS規(guī)則。

3、提交時,可根據(jù)工蜂單文件大小限制,提示用戶將超限文件納入Git LFS管理。

4、支持單倉庫或多倉庫清理LFS緩存,快速解決磁盤空間不足問題。

5、支持使用UGit本地LFS Cache加速服務(wù),體驗極致的下載速度。

6、支持超大文件(>4GB)的無損下載。

【快速提交】

原生Git提交流程,如果遠程有新的提交,Git會強制要求先更新再提交,在一個大型項目中,提交流程會因為遠程頻繁變更而不停中斷,影響工作效率。UGit的快速提交,可以實現(xiàn)只要用戶提交的文件其他人沒修改,可以在不更新情況下直接完成提交,不會因遠程頻繁變更而中斷提交流程,讓大型團隊協(xié)作更加流暢。

【工蜂鎖】

1、工蜂鎖是針對游戲項目中存在大量二進制文件協(xié)作場景而設(shè)計的鎖方案,解決了Git LFS Lock的穩(wěn)定性和性能問題。

2、支持對文件、目錄進行加解鎖。同時也可以支持全分支鎖,即加鎖一個對象時,同時鎖定所有分支上的該對象。

3、支持項目設(shè)置強制加鎖工作流,要求用戶必須先加鎖才能提交。

4、支持推送變更到遠程后,自動對推送內(nèi)容進行解鎖。

5、也可以配置路徑的鎖白名單,限定配置的目錄只允許特定用戶可以加解鎖。

功能特色

1、加速服務(wù)

支持Git LFS緩存加速、UE4 DDC、Unity Cache

2、支持客戶端鉤子(python/shell/batch)

可使用鉤子腳本定制團隊工作流,如提交規(guī)范檢查

3、定時任務(wù)

包括定時鎖分支、定時更新(下載LFS數(shù)據(jù)/pull/pull -f三種策略)

4、倉庫同步服務(wù)

支持Git/SVN/P4任意兩種倉庫之間互相按Commit維度進行單向或雙向同步,也可進行倉庫遷移

5、分支規(guī)則管理

可一鍵鎖定符合規(guī)則的分支;

6、多倉庫管理

Git Submodule的替代方案,通過可視化操作,旨在解決大型項目多倉庫依賴管理問題,支持批量克隆,一鍵更新、拉分支、切分支等等

7、倉庫分組管理

可以對倉庫進行分組管理,并且分組信息會展示在倉庫標(biāo)簽上

8、變更集分組

可對工作區(qū)變更進行分組管理,按分組進行提交

9、集成CodeAction

不用克隆倉庫就可以進行代碼審查

10、支持Excel Diff&Merge

支持單元格內(nèi)容、公式,暫不支持表格樣式

11、版本標(biāo)記

支持在UGit倉庫歷史中標(biāo)記版本為好的、壞的、標(biāo)星等操作,方便版本回溯或版本信息共享;

更新日志

v5.26.1版本

1、外網(wǎng)無法訪問Ifs和ignore的模板鏈接。

2、極簡模式開關(guān)調(diào)整。

載地址

  • 電腦版

網(wǎng)友評論

0條評論
(您的評論需要經(jīng)過審核才能顯示)